The BC changes depending on your rifle/barrel, velocity, range (velocity related) and environmental conditions.

Here is a graph derived from actual average velocity figures over 50, 100, and 200 yards which I researched when the Kings first came out some 9 or 10 yrs ago. The best fit line interpolation and extrapolation shows what you may expect and according to the criteria mentioned in pg 1.

Note that in one respondent's figures above, the bc was taken at an mv similar to my figure figure shown at 150 yards and the bc is similar when actual velocity is matched.
